
CELTIC CRYSTAL VISITOR CENTRE
If you are looking for a unique and authentic craft experience in Galway, you should visit the Celtic Crystal Visitor Centre in Moycullen. Here you can learn about the history and culture of Irish crystal, watch the master craftsmen create stunning Celtic designs on crystal glassware and jewellery, and shop for exclusive and exquisite pieces that reflect the beauty and heritage of Ireland.
The Celtic Crystal Visitor Centre offers three different experiences to suit your preferences and budget. You can choose from a short tour and glass cutting demonstration, a master cutter experience, or an ultimate master cutter experience. Each experience will give you a chance to meet the family behind the business, explore the crystal gallery, and witness the amazing skill and artistry of the master cutters.
The short tour and glass cutting demonstration is free of charge and takes about 15 minutes. You will get an informative talk on the creation and design of Celtic Crystal, followed by a live demonstration of how the master cutters use traditional stone cutting wheels to engrave Celtic motifs such as the Claddagh, Shamrock, and Celtic Knotwork on crystal glassware. You can ask questions, take photos, and admire the finished products.
The master cutter experience costs €125 and takes about 35 minutes. It is suitable for small groups of 2-6 people. You will get a private tour of the crystal gallery, where you can see one-of-a-kind pieces of crystal that showcase the history and techniques of Celtic Crystal. You will then be introduced to one of the master cutters, who will cut a design on a bowl especially for your group. You can choose between a Shamrock or Claddagh Ring design with Celtic Knotwork banding and a signature Irish Rose design on the base. The bowl will be signed by the master cutter and posted to you within 4-6 weeks.
The ultimate master cutter experience is a once-in-a-lifetime opportunity to create your own unique piece of Connemara Celtic Crystal. It costs €500 and takes about 2-2.5 hours. It is a VIP craft experience that will allow you to work closely with one of the master cutters to design and cut your own piece of crystal. You will get a personal welcome and guidance from a family member, a tour of the crystal gallery, and a consultation with the master cutter to discuss your ideas and preferences. You will then watch as he cuts your design on a piece of crystal that you have chosen from a selection of shapes and colours. You will also get to try your hand at cutting some simple patterns on a practice piece of crystal. Your finished piece will be signed by the master cutter and posted to you within 4-6 weeks.

The Celtic Crystal Visitor Centre is a family-owned and operated business that has been producing high-quality Irish crystal since 1978. It is one of the few remaining crystal factories in Ireland today and the only one that specialises in traditional Irish design on crystal.
